Evidence supporting the use of: Phellodendron amurense
For the health condition: Anxiety
Synopsis
Source of validity: Traditional
Rating (out of 5): 2
Phellodendron amurense, commonly known as Amur cork tree, has a long history of use in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M). It is often combined with other herbs, such as Magnolia officinalis, in formulas designed to "calm the spirit" and reduce stress or anxiety symptoms. The most well-known formula containing Phellodendron is called "Relora" (a proprietary blend of Phellodendron and Magnolia extracts), which is marketed for stress and anxiety relief.
The evidence supporting Phellodendron’s use for anxiety is largely traditional and anecdotal. Historical texts suggest its use to clear "heat" and dampness from the body, which in TCM theory can manifest as emotional disturbances, including anxiety. Modern human studies on Phellodendron alone for anxiety are lacking; most available research focuses on the Relora blend. These small clinical trials suggest some potential for reducing stress and cortisol levels, but the evidence is preliminary, and it is not possible to attribute effects specifically to Phellodendron without further research.
In summary, the use of Phellodendron amurense for anxiety is primarily supported by traditional usage in TCM. Scientific validation is limited, with a lack of robust clinical trials examining its isolated effects on anxiety. More rigorous studies are needed to evaluate its efficacy and safety for this indication.
